Understanding the Kentucky Non-Discrimination Statement
The Kentucky Non-Discrimination Statement serves as a crucial legal document that outlines protections against discrimination for recipients of Federal financial assistance under the Workforce Investment Act. This statement is defined as a formal declaration that ensures individuals are treated fairly and equitably in various areas, including employment and education. Its significance lies in the comprehensive safeguards it offers, which are vital for fostering an inclusive environment.
The statement under the Workforce Investment Act underscores the importance of equal opportunity by highlighting specific protections, including prohibiting discrimination based on race, color, religion, sex, national origin, age, disability, and political affiliation.
